  • Abstract
    Recent control theoretic studies have shown that the sharing of electronic control unit (ECU) bandwidth among multiple controllers can be adaptively regulated to achieve better control performance as opposed to static bandwidth allocation to each controller. Unfortunately the ideal controllers cannot always be implemented, since the computational platform does not admit unrestricted choice of sampling periods for the controllers. Therefore the controllers for each combination of the sampling rates must be pre-synthesized. This paper develops an algorithmic basis for identifying the optimal feasible combination of sampling rates at various modes of a system consisting of multiple controllers. The proposed approach is shown to yield controllers that are feasible and having comparable benefits as compared to the ideal controllers.
